Transaction 77de24aef3a898e17fea6b1199786332f720e3f224ffa2ca0fdf751f30a4e743
1 Input
1 Output
-
77de24aef3a898e17fea6b1199786332f720e3f224ffa2ca0fdf751f30a4e743:0
- value
- 9919644
- script pubkey
- OP_0 OP_PUSHBYTES_32 ac6d2911fd88b5cab1ec3622245589d10bd0bef4d55fd10bab897d69d1453042
- address
- bc1q43kjjy0a3z6u4v0vxc3zg4vf6y9ap0h5640azzat397kn529xppqs3gwx8